Transaction 3d10c35daec83a79598aa8b92db2036854800f5230ca41615dc77c2cc2b9bf5d
1 Input
2 Outputs
- 3d10c35daec83a79598aa8b92db2036854800f5230ca41615dc77c2cc2b9bf5d:0
- 3d10c35daec83a79598aa8b92db2036854800f5230ca41615dc77c2cc2b9bf5d:1
value 265500
address 3FrjJCdUStChTEVJMJnC57k6zuPe9uf3vE
value 2944232
address 155cusRxM318rpUmARKevSFtNsFj7Kg9y4